I just went through this and a google search will yield lots of great articles on this subject.   What I learned that in my case and I bleive its true for most if you rent more than few weeks a year, was that in the US your regular homeowners insurance likely will NOT cover injury or damage relating to operating short term vacation rental business. 

 

I was pleased to find that the coverage was not that much more expensive than tranditional "Condo/Renters" insurance but I would check with your insurace agent.  There seems to only be a few insurance companies covering this market. 

 

I am renting a condo that I rent time and dont' live anywhere near it.  Your situation might be different!
